Types of Electrical Loom Tubes
There are several types of electrical loom tubes available today, each designed to cater to specific requirements
1. Convoluted Tubing This type of tubing features a ribbed structure that allows flexibility and can expand or contract under pressure. Convoluted tubing is often used in automotive applications where wiring needs to withstand vibrations and movements.
2. Spiral Wrap Consisting of a continuous strip of material wound in a spiral form, this wrap provides excellent protection against abrasion and is frequently used in robotics and manufacturing equipment.

3. Heat Shrink Tubing This specialized type of loom tube is utilized primarily for insulation purposes. When exposed to heat, it shrinks to tightly conform to the underlying wire, providing an extra layer of insulation and protection.
4. Flexible Looms These tubes are designed to accommodate multiple wires and offer a high degree of flexibility. They are ideal for applications with complex wiring requirements, such as consumer electronics.
Applications of Electrical Loom Tubes
The applications of electrical loom tubes span across various industries, illustrating their versatility and importance. In the automotive industry, loom tubes are essential for protecting electrical connections and preventing wear due to vibrations, heat, and environmental exposure. In industrial settings, they help manage networks of cables, contributing to safer and more organized environments.
Moreover, electrical loom tubes are also prevalent in consumer electronics. They provide protection to delicate wiring found in mobile phones, computers, and home appliances, ensuring both performance and longevity. In the aerospace industry, these tubes are vital for maintaining the integrity of electrical systems amidst extreme conditions.
